Subject: Office move — Harwick Lane receiving arrangements

Dear Dispatch Desk,

Ahead of the Quillbrook Analytics relocation on the 14th, please confirm the loading bay at Harwick Lane will be staffed from 07:30. The sealed crates from our Fernside office must be logged individually on arrival, and the two grey document cases kept aside for the facilities lead, Marta Keel. For those two cases, the courier hand-over must follow this instruction exactly.

handover note for yagef-bagep: the drudor pelius courier leaves the kasdor zorvan norir ledger at gate 8016 under passcode 755406

// Quick setup for the CrumbTrail queue client — this is the bit that
// triggers log compaction on the Burrowmill brokers. Compaction runs
// nightly; don't kick it manually unless the backlog alert fires.
// Worth mentioning at the eng sync: retention dropped to 7 days.
// Auth goes through the internal Burrowmill admin API, key below.

app token of kagap-fafop = zpat7_kxsDrhD

**Visitor policy — Intern cohort arrivals.** The Tarnwick Systems summer intern cohort arrives on the first Monday of the programme and will be processed as a group at the Elmsgate Building main entrance. Interns count as visitors until their permanent badges are printed, so each must be signed in by a named host and remain escorted in all secure areas. Hosts should pre-register their interns through the front desk portal no later than the preceding Thursday. For the interim turnstile access, use the code below.

badge for fafop-fajof: bdg-Z-47